Your acceptance letter will tell you the automatic scholarships you will receive. Don’t forget to apply for other scholarships Northwest offers.
Complete the Standard Scholarship Application to apply for major-specific scholarships in CatPAWS after you are accepted. To be eligible for these scholarships, you much complete the Standard Scholarship Application by Feb. 1. Review Northwest additional scholarship information at nwmissouri.edu/finaid.

Transfer Awards
Transfer Distinguished Scholarship
- Initial Requirements: 3.50 Northwest cumulative GPA and completion of 24 credit hours per academic year.
- Award: $2,500
- Maximum Award: Six semesters within consecutive academic years.
Transfer Academic Scholarship
- Initial Requirements: 3.30 Northwest cumulative GPA and completion of 24 credit hours per academic year.
- Award: $1,500
- Maximum Award: Six semesters within consecutive academic years.
Transfer Merit
- Initial Requirements: Renews to the University Scholarship program with completion of 24 credit hours per academic year and a Northwest cumulative GPA of 3.30.
- Award: $1,000 Maximum Award:
- Six semesters of Transfer Merit and 6 trimesters of University Scholarship.
Phi Theta Kappa Scholarship
- Initial Requirements: 3.50 cumulative GPA in transfer, 24 transferable credit hours completed by time of application. Must be accepted for admission by May 1 and first-time student at Northwest, indicate Phi Theta Kappa membership on application.
- Award: $3500
- Notification to student by May 20, copy of Phi Theta Kappa certificate of membership
- Renewal Requirements: Minimum 3.50 Northwest cumulative GPA and completion of 24 credit hours per academic year.
- Maximum Award: Six semesters within consecutive academic years.
Bearcat Advantage
- Out-of-state students can earn IN-STATE rates through the Bearcat Advantage.
- Average award: $6,652
